About The Position

The Shipping Supervisor oversees outbound shipping operations in a dairy manufacturing facility, ensuring accurate, timely shipments while maintaining food safety, quality, and regulatory compliance. This role supervises shipping staff, engages in carrier schedules, monitors inventory accuracy, and ensures proper product handling and temperature control. This position works closely with production, quality, and warehouse teams to support efficient, compliant, and on-time deliveries.

Responsibilities

  • Enforces safety rules and company policies.
  • Ensures that all required inbound/outbound documentation is complete and has been properly processed in the inventory management system.
  • Maintains proper inventory levels to support customer orders and demands.
  • Operates forklift as needed.
  • Plans accordingly to minimize production disruptions due to unplanned absences/circumstances.
  • Effectively communicates and coordinates product and resource availability within the production department.
  • Actively engages in waste reduction efforts in all areas, including fluid milk, ingredients, packaging, finished products, labor, and loss prevention.
  • Monitors and records necessary waste tracking documentation.
  • Maintains high sanitation standards by enforcing equipment and area cleanliness.
  • Ensures all required process control documentation is completed.
  • Investigates and immediately reports all incidents involving company equipment or personnel.
  • Oversees shipping activities to ensure accuracy and condition of shipments.
  • Inspects material handling equipment and cooler/warehouse daily for defects.
  • Immediately notifies chain of command of any needed repairs.
  • Instructs forklift drivers and equipment operators on job duties once certification is completed.
  • Coordinates loadout and communication with branch locations, 3rd party hauling companies, and vendors.
